Miley Cyrusâ Marie Claire interview for the March 2011 edition delves into a topic that shocked even her biggest criticsâa video taped bong hit that surfaced back in December. Find out what she had to say about the incident here.
Finally the former Disney star seems ready to talk about the now infamous clip of her chocking down an epic hit from a water pipeâof salvia, of course. I suppose it took an interview opportunity with the mag to clear the air.
About the incident, she admits that she is ânot perfectâ and that she âdisappointed her fans.â
But it would be her answer to the next question that revealed just how humbling the scandal was for her. When asked if she regrets doing it, even though smoking salvia has become especially popular among people her age, she implied that her status as a ârole modelâ separates her from the norm, and that ââŚit was a bad decisionâŚbecause of what I stand for.â
